Study Guide: The Lion and the Jewel by Wole Soyinka is a detailed analysis of one of Wole Soyinka’s earlier plays, The Lion and the Jewel. The comic play borders around the struggle between a mock of Western “civilization” and “medieval” African culture, a conflict between beauty and wit, etcetera. The play has, as its principal characters, Sidi, Lakunle, Baroka and Sadiku. Baroka and Sidi are the titular characters of this play. Baroka is the lion while Sidi is the jewel.
The Lion and the Jewel pits the African culture against the Western civilization. Lakunle, the primary school teacher and a been-to-the-city, is a beacon of the Western civilisation and its liberties, the caricature of a modern educated man. Baroka is a paragon of African values, wisdom, and knowledge. Thus, the thematic focus of the play is the clash between tradition and modernity.
